Html5 canvas save as pdf

Now when we are able to draw on web with canvas, we may feel need to save the generated image data as a image. Understanding save and restore for the canvas context. The html element is used to draw graphics, on the fly, via javascript. And then you can save the image as required format. If the height or width of the canvas is 0 or larger than the maximum canvas size, the string data. How to print or save a quiz as a pdf in canvas youtube. Net community by providing forums questionanswer site where people can help each other. Html5 canvas provides two important methods to save and restore the canvas states. Apr 22, 2010 now when we are able to draw on web with canvas, we may feel need to save the generated image data as a image. The presence of the canvas api for html5, strengthens the html5 platform by providing twodimensional drawing capabilities. Aug 27, 2016 learn very easy way to make pdf from html within less than 3 minutes jspdf download link. In this video ill be showing you how to convert an html5 canvas into a downloadable or viewable png or jpg image. Convert html to pdf, html to pdf converter pdfreactor. To save the values of your drawing state properties to them at later stages use method save 2.

Generate multipage pdf using single canvas of html document. In this blog, i will demonstrate how to generate pdf file of your html page with css using javascript and jquery. How to print or save a quiz as a pdf in canvas cyrus helf. The canvas drawing state is basically a snapshot of all the styles and transformations that have been applied and consists of the followings. This course is adapted to your level as well as all html5 pdf courses to better enrich your knowledge. A browser like chrome already has a plugin to do that, but firefox and internet explorer do not. Written by developers who have been using the new language for the past year in their work, this book shows you how to start adapting the language now to realize its benefits on todays browsers. This modified text is an extract of the original stack overflow documentation created by following contributors and released under cc bysa 3. Pdf on the fly mit javascript stil mit stil mediaevent. It was pretty clear that we need to use the html5 canvas element and to capture the pointer movements. The site does not provide any warranties for the posted content. This canvas tutorial demonstrates how you can use canvas to play with color, texture, and lighting scenarios. To save the canvas drawing as an image, we can set the source of an image object to the image data url.

This library creates a pdf representation of your canvas element, unlike the other proposed solutions which embed an image in a pdf document. Js uses javascript typed array and xhr level 2 for pdf binary stream processing, also utilizes web worker and html5 canvas to render pdf in readonly mode. I need to save a vector graphics version of the canvas in p5. A minimalist example of using html5 canvas to save signature.

Aug 27, 2018 i need to save a vector graphics version of the canvas in p5. I have several pdf files that id like to export as html5. This quick video will show you an easy way to embed a pdf or any document in a pageassignment in the canvas lms so that the content of the. Rendering interactive pdf forms in browser relies on some new features in html5. It works very fine but now i need to save the image with a normal filename and. In this quick tutorial, i show you how to load a pdf file and render its contents on an html5 canvas using pdf. Here mudassar ahmed khan has explained with an example, how to convert export html table to pdf file using javascript. Html5 pdf viewer for ease of viewing pdf files on your. Take advantage of this course called html5 canvas tutorial to improve your web development skills and better understand html5.

For other browsers firefox and edge you will need to use a 3rd party webp encoder such as libwebp javascript encoding webp images via javascript is slow. Capture signature using html5 canvas use for ipad, iphone, android tablets and phones with the help of html5 canvas its very easy to draw stuff such as lines, arcs, rectangle etc. Pdfreactor is the perfect printing component to convert html to pdf files in a highquality way. For quickly archiving a web page these html file converters will serve you with the basic functions either from html or an url. Oct 02, 2012 rendering interactive pdf forms in browser relies on some new features in html5. Rendering html5 canvas to pdf documents using aspose. Nov 03, 2016 this quick video will show you an easy way to embed a pdf or any document in a pageassignment in the canvas lms so that the content of the document, and not jut a link to it, is shown on the page. Learn very easy way to make pdf from html within less than 3 minutes jspdf download link. The latest versions of firefox, safari, chrome and opera all support for html5 canvas but ie8 does not support canvas natively. Html5 canvas save and restore states tutorialspoint. Aug 30, 2018 here mudassar ahmed khan has explained with an example, how to convert export html table to pdf file using javascript. I am working in html5 and using canvas as a designing tool. If youre looking for a free download links of html5 canvas cookbook pdf, epub, docx and torrent then this site is not for you.

So, your pdf file will display correctly to those who are on your website using chrome. Understanding save and restore for the canvas context july 10, 2010 july 26, 20 by james litten at first, i had a hard time grasping the purpose and use of the save and restore methods of the canvas 2d context. Sep, 2017 how to print or save a quiz as a pdf in canvas cyrus helf. Detecting mouse position on the canvas this example will show how to get the mouse position relative to the canvas, such that 0,0 will be the topleft hand corner of the html5 canvas. Following is a simple example which makes use of above mentioned methods. The html table will be first converted into a html5 canvas using html2canvas plugin and then the html5 canvas will be exported to pdf file using the pdfmake plugin in javascript.

Mar 31, 2014 while working on a proposal for a project, i wanted to have a look at the possibilities of capturing the signature of client in ancontinue readinga minimalist example of using html5 canvas to save signature as image using web api. Zetakey html5 browser html5 capture signature canvas example. Iam trying to save html5 canvas content as image using js. Is there another possible way like canvas to img and then img to pdf. The canvas api is a powerful tool for creating images and it can also be used to place graphics in pdf documents. I cant get them convered as the xaml is serialized. Pdf html5 canvas tutorial computer tutorials in pdf. Alternatively, we could also open up a new browser window with the image data.

Jan 10, 2019 in this quick tutorial, i show you how to load a pdf file and render its contents on an html5 canvas using pdf. Core html5 canvas graphics, animation, and game development david geary upper saddle river, nj boston indianapolis san francisco new york toronto montreal london munich paris madrid. Html5 canvas drawing and saving image this is a javascript sample to capture a signature in a canvas area. This means not all browsers are compatible with this approach, primarily for ie. Here is a simple canvas element which has only two specific attributes width and height plus all the core html5 attributes like id, name and class, etc. In this tutorial, we will demonstrate methods of saving the content of a html5 canvas object using server side scripting. In this code drawing on a canvas is saves as a xmlxaml file. Is it possible to directly convert canvas to pdf using javascript pdf. While working on a proposal for a project, i wanted to have a look at the possibilities of capturing the signature of client in ancontinue readinga minimalist example of using html5 canvas to save signature as image using web api. All you need to do is download the training document, open it and start learning html5 for free. Capture signature using html5 canvas use for ipad, iphone.

Canvas element attributes name type default width unsigned long 300. How to convert canvas to pdf konva javascript 2d canvas library. All you need to do is download the training document, open it. Html5 canvas element tutorial html5 canvas tutorials. Convert export html table to pdf file using javascript. The html5 canvas element is an html tag similar to the, or tag, with the exception that its contents are rendered with jav. The signatures then gets embedded into a generated pdf document together with the results of the checklist. In this blog, i will demonstrate how to generate a pdf file of your html page with css using javascript and jquery. This method will push your current drawing state on a stack of saved drawing states,such that it can be retrived at a later stage within the code. Its functions go way beyond online tools that save html pages as pdf.

Convert html5 canvas to image png or jpg javascript. Alternatively, we could also open up a new browser window with the image data url directly and the user could save it from there. Capturing a signature on a mobile devices such as ipads, android tablets and smart phones has so many uses in our day to to day business applications. From there, a user can right click on the image to save it to their local computer. Detecting mouse position on the canvas this example will show how to get the mouse position relative to the canvas, such that 0,0 will. If you save a pdf as html web page the resulting html will have the following doctype. I know you can export as html from version xi, but im wondering if its html5. Capture html canvas as gifjpgpngpdf html5 provides canvas to data url mimetype. It can be used to draw graphs, make photo compositions or do simple and not so simple animations.

Canvas is a powerful drawing technology for the web. Jul 10, 2010 understanding save and restore for the canvas context july 10, 2010 july 26, 20 by james litten at first, i had a hard time grasping the purpose and use of the save and restore methods of the canvas 2d context. This tutorial from codepen shows you how to use html5 to create a cool, 70s inspired effect with animated blooming flowers. Canvas is a new element in html5, which provides apis that allow you to dynamically generate and render graphics, charts, images, and animation. These capabilities are supported on most modern operating systems and browsers. May 27, 2019 in this video ill be showing you how to convert an html5 canvas into a downloadable or viewable png or jpg image. The drawing state that gets saved onto a stack consists of. Colors, styles and shadows attributes name type default. Attributes name type canvas htmlcanvasobject readonly methods return name void save void restore transformation methods return name void scale float x, float y. The signatures must be created on a web ui, running on an ipad pro. The html canvas element is used to draw graphics on a web page. Php will be used in this example, but the technique can be applied in other languages as well. In this blog, we have to add two external js files for converting the.

174 72 577 1 1500 675 156 803 1291 1366 101 145 833 38 604 454 761 204 598 173 581 689 39 613 1054 367 366 1421 475 641 1246 488 27 716 1132 1228 361 898 960 156 391 1454